I keep trying to push an image to my Container Registry and have the following error, over and over and over.

2df70cee25f4: Pushing [==================================================>]  98.97MB
fd6fd1b38aa6: Pushing   5.12kB
eed5e724bb3f: Pushing [==================================================>]  3.584kB
39519b1d4243: Pushing [==================================================>]  673.3kB
d3a2e66169a4: Pushing [==================================================>]    158MB
bda6db3aeddf: Pushing [==================================================>]  1.303MB
1218b2cb2178: Pushing [==================================================>]  4.533MB
35fad31e25bc: Pushing [==================================================>]  31.74kB
162d1528e8f2: Retrying in 5 seconds
f9fdf403761e: Retrying in 7 seconds
1091b2242301: Retrying in 4 seconds
6535dbe050f8: Waiting
478dbb6fa9b9: Waiting
a574f1b5dd09: Waiting
74ff7c20c1be: Waiting
7e77b50d4b08: Waiting
20ad77933d0c: Waiting
7fa9f3915e68: Waiting
8d26f4bbe9d1: Waiting
5cd34c065b53: Waiting
d49465772d36: Waiting
6dabd9bfb6b6: Waiting
86f857e82f5f: Waiting
e81bff2725db: Waiting

It’ll push layers. Then say it will retry. Then eventually it dies at EOF. As far as I know there isn’t an easy way to debug what could be the error.

I made sure to run doctl registry login.

I was able to push the image to Docker Hub without error.

Docker Desktop for macOS v4.0.1

Engine 20.10.8

It looks like it was due to my Netgear router blocking for spam.